Which measures help prevent hypothermia during pneumoperitoneum?

Explanation:
Preventing hypothermia during pneumoperitoneum relies on reducing heat loss and adding warmth from multiple sources. The gas used to inflate the abdomen is cold and dry, so humidifying and warming this gas helps minimize cooling of the peritoneum and the body's core. Pairing that with warming intravenous fluids, a forced-air warming device (bear hugger), warmed irrigation solutions, and warming the ambient air provides heat through several pathways, reducing both conductive and evaporative losses. Merely using cold dry gas or avoiding warming devices would promote cooling, while relying on room temperature alone isn’t enough to maintain normothermia.
